How to Roast a Pumpkin

Step 1: Preheat your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it (200 degrees Celsius).
Cut the pumpkin in half with a large knife.
Scoop out the stringy innards of the pumpkin along with the seeds.
Set the seeds aside and prepare toasted pumpkin seeds later. , Puncture the outer skin of the pumpkin with the tip of a large chef's knife.
Set the knife into the groove created by the puncture and slowly sink the knife into the pumpkin using a rocking motion.
The thicker your slices, the longer your pumpkin will take to roast.
Therefore, it's recommended to cut about 1-inch thick slices, leaving enough time to develop good caramelization on the outer surface of the pumpkin. , Place pumpkin wedges on a large roasting tray and drizzle generously with olive oil., Salt and pepper make a fine combo, but why not experiment a little bit for some out-of-the-ordinary combos? Try:
Garam Masala Cumin and curry powder Clove, cinnamon, and brown sugar Maple syrup Red pepper , Roast your pumpkin wedges for about 20 minutes.
If your pumpkin wedges are slightly larger than 1-inch thick, roast for 25 minutes and check every 5 minutes thereafter.
If your pumpkin wedges are slightly smaller than 1-inch thick, roast for 15 minutes and check every 5 minutes thereafter. -
